# Neuro-Ophthalmology
* **Definition:** A subspecialty of ophthalmology that focuses on the relationship between the nervous system and the eyes.

### Innovations, Trends, and Initiatives
- **Telemedicine in neuro-ophthalmology**: The adoption of telehealth services to provide remote consultations and follow-ups for patients with neuro-ophthalmic conditions.
- **Neos™ System**: Utilizes a VR headset to gamify eye movement and pupillary response assessments, providing objective measurements for neuro-ophthalmic conditions in a clinical setting.
- **AI in Neuro-Ophthalmology**: The integration of AI technologies is enhancing diagnostic accuracy and treatment personalization in neuro-ophthalmology.
